Abstract

The present invention relates to a temperature and light regulation and control technical method for half-smooth tongue sole parent fish to spawn. The present invention comprises two aspects, wherein one aspect is the optimization of parent fish and the breeding intensification, and the other aspect is that the breeding water temperature and the light irradiation is artificially regulated and controlled to make the parent fish oviposit. The present invention has the technical key points of the breeding of half-smoothing tongue sole, the regulating mode of the water temperature, the regulating mode of the light irradiation, and the arrangement of owl-light lamps, etc. The sexual glands of the parent fish of the half-smoothing tongue sole are synchronously mature, the spawning is carried out naturally, the spawning time is fixed and concentrated every time, and multitudinous fertilized eggs of good quality and high fertilized rate can be obtained. The present invention is a set of complete control technical method. Through production experiments, the whole breeding population fertilized rate can reach 92% during the breeding period, the hatching rate can reach 86.5%, the spawning period can reach one and a half months, and the fecundity is increased by 50% than that in the natural world.

The present invention realizes by following technical scheme: main contents comprise that parent fish preferably cultivates water temperature and illumination with reinforced cultivating and regulation and control and make parent fish two aspects of laying eggs:
One, the preferred and reinforced cultivating of parent fish: comprise that preferred, breeding condition of parent fish and feedstuff feed:
1, parent fish preferably reaches breeding condition: the parent fish of preferred normal body colour, health, and raun is more than 3 ages, and total length reaches 40-60 centimetre, body weight 1300-3000 gram; Milter reached more than 3 ages, and total length 20-35 centimetre, body weight reaches the 200-700 gram.Parent fish is put into special-purpose temperature light regulation and control and cultivates pond (25m 2), stocking density 1~3 tail/m 2, body weight 2~3kg/m 212~25 ℃ of anniversary water temperatures.Flowing water is cultivated, rate of water exchange 400%, and water is changed in regularly clear pond.Condition of water quality requires: dissolved oxygen>6.0mg/L, and PH scope: 7.6-8.2, salinity 28-33 ‰.
2, the feedstuff of parent fish and feeding:
The feedstuff of parent fish: bait is based on the clam worm that lives, shellfish meat.
Feeding of parent fish: day throw something and feed 2 times, a day feeding volume is the 2%-3% of fish body body weight, and the reinforcement that began to carry out living bait preceding 3 months of mating period is thrown something and fed, and promotes the growth of parent fish gonad, keeps the high rate of throwing something and feeding whole mating period.When parent fish begins to lay eggs, change the clam worm alive of throwing something and feeding fully into.When throwing something and feeding, note avoiding noise, and in time remove residual bait, blowdown.
Two, water temperature, illumination control technique: comprise the regulation and control of water temperature regulate and control, illumination.
1, water temperature regulate and control:
Before temperature, illumination regulation and control, the cultivation water temperature of Cynoglossus semilaevis is controlled at 16-17 ℃, natural lighting, intensity of illumination is about 100Lux; 2-3 is individual month before arriving idiophase, begins to regulate and control water temperature, when natural temperature is raised to 18 ℃, and the beginning temperature control.Temperature control method: water temperature slowly promoted 1 ℃ in per 7 days, remained unchanged and stayed for some time after being raised to 25 ℃.The ratio of waiting to observe parent fish total length and gonad length reaches at 1: 0.51 o'clock, and water temperature is descended 1 ℃, keeps 24 ℃ of constant wait parent fishs and lays eggs.Water temperature is by boiler or refrigeration machine regulation and control height, day rate of water exchange 400%-500%.The variation of 12 monitorings every day water temperature, accuracy controlling variations in temperature every day is in ± 0.2 ℃ of scope.
2, the regulation and control of illumination:
In the temperature adjusting process, when being raised to 19 ℃, water temperature begins to carry out the illumination regulation and control.
1). the parent fish rearing pond is hidden fully with the light tight tarpaulin of black, highly locate for 1 meter to hang electric filament lamp at the cultivation pond water surface, the adjusting intensity of illumination is 280Lux.
2). the adjusting of the illumination rhythm and pace of moving things: the control light application time is 8 hours when water temperature is 19 ℃, increases light application time 30 minutes in later per 5 days, reaches 13 hours and remains unchanged until light application time, accurately manages the light application time of every day with intervalometer.
3). the setting of evening lamp: when light application time reaches 12 hours every days, begin to be provided with evening lamp, on the basis of former light application time, increase half-light according to the time.Evening lamp promptly adds an electric filament lamp (60W) in the central authorities that are positioned at the cultivation pond apart from water surface 1m place, be connected to other control light modulation and cultivate on the pond outer variable resistance and intervalometer, utilize variable resistance and intervalometer to regulate and control intensity of illumination and weaken gradually, reduced to behind the 50Lux prolonged exposure gradually 15 minutes by 280Lux.Lighting time is along with the prolongation of the normal illumination time 30min of postponing every day.
The present invention and prior art contrast its characteristics:
The present invention is according to the natural law of Cynoglossus semilaevis parent fish gonad development, and premenarcheal reinforced cultivating adopts temperature and illumination control method, make the parent fish gonad grow synchronously and in cultivating the pond nature, concentrate, lay eggs in batches.
The present invention is according to the research of physiological ecology, in the long interpolation evening lamp illumination when reaching 1: 0.51 above gonadal maturation of Cynoglossus semilaevis parent fish total length and gonad.The effect of evening lamp is simulate natural ecological environment, and the natural environment that the Cynoglossus semilaevis parent fish is experienced under the simulated conditions gradually changes, and impels male and female parent fish gonad to grow synchronously and the synchronous spawning fertilization, and the regulation and control parent fish laid eggs in regular time every day.And the regulation and control of parent fish in the past egg-laying time under the condition of not adding evening lamp is unfixing, often can not determine egg-laying time, has missed the best opportunity of receiving ovum and hatching, has increased the difficulty of artificial breeding.
The present invention adopts automatic control technology, with variable resistance and intervalometer accuracy controlling light application time and intensity of illumination, has avoided because the acute variation of illumination that manual operation brings accidentally and temperature makes parent fish produce emergency reaction.
The present invention strengthens fortification in regulation and control water temperature and illumination, when treating the parent fish gonad development with maturation, slowly regulate water temperature again and illumination suitably reduces, and discharges to promote sophisticated ovum.Conditions such as the water temperature between the whole egg-laying season, illumination, nutrition reach the best, make that Cynoglossus semilaevis parent fish egg-laying time prolongs half wheat harvesting period than nature under the artificial regulatory condition, and egg laying amount also increases greatly.By above measure, can obtain large batch of high quality fertilized egg of scophthatmus, fertilization rate reached to 92%, incubation rate reaches 86.6%.

This research is carried out at Huanghai Sea Aquatic product institute Mai Dao proving ground and Qingdao loyal sea water product company limited respectively, and specific implementation process is as follows:
Embodiment one: carry out the preliminary experiment of laying eggs of temperature, illumination regulation and control Cynoglossus semilaevis parent fish in Huanghai Sea Aquatic product institute Mai Dao proving ground.
1). parent fish is selected and throws something and feeds:
Cynoglossus semilaevis parent fish 30 tails are selected in experiment for use, 12 tail rauns, 18 tail milters, raun average weight 2116 grams, milter average weight 257 grams.The parent fish bodily form, body colour are normal, healthy not damaged (the normal body colour Cynoglossus semilaevis body back side is brown or crineous, and the outside of belly is a milky).The parent fish age: raun and milter were for 3 ages.
Parent fish is put into rectangle and smears angle cultivation pond (25m 2, 1 meter of the depth of water) cultivate.Cultivating water is the sand filtration nature seawater, and condition of water quality is: DO>6.0mg/L, pH=7.9-8.2, salinity 30-32.Long face at the bottom of cultivating the pond and wide are provided with scale, with the ratio of timely measurement parent fish gonad and total length, and the law of development of grasp parent fish gonad under the artificial regulatory condition.
The fodder and bait of parent fish is based on the clam worm that lives, shellfish meat.Day throw something and feed 2 times, say the 2%-3% that feeding volume is a fish body body weight, the reinforcement that began to carry out living bait preceding 3 months of mating period is thrown something and fed, and promotes the growth of parent fish gonad, keeps the high rate of throwing something and feeding whole mating period.When parent fish begins to lay eggs, change the clam worm alive of throwing something and feeding fully into.When throwing something and feeding, note avoiding noise, and in time remove residual bait, blowdown.
2). parent fish water temperature, illumination regulation and control:
Before temperature, illumination regulation and control, the cultivation water temperature of Cynoglossus semilaevis is controlled at 16-17 ℃, natural lighting, intensity of illumination is about 100Lux; 2-3 is individual month before arriving idiophase, begin to regulate and control water temperature, water temperature begins to raise by 18 ℃ gradually, raise 1 ℃ in per 7 days until being increased to 25 ℃ and remain unchanged, when finding that parent fish has (the long ratio with total length of parent fish gonad this moment reaches 0.51) when laying eggs on a small quantity, water temperature is descended 0.5 ℃ to 24 ℃ and keep stable every day.
The parent fish rearing pond is hidden fully with the light tight tarpaulin of black, highly locate for 1 meter to hang electric filament lamp at the cultivation pond water surface, the control intensity of illumination is 280Lux.The regulation and control light application time is 8 hours when water temperature is 19 ℃, increases light application time 30 minutes in later per 5 days, reaches 13 hours and remains unchanged until light application time, accurately manages the light application time of every day with intervalometer.
Evening lamp is set: when light application time reaches 12 hours every days, begin to be provided with evening lamp (on the basis of former light application time, increasing half-light) according to the time.Evening lamp promptly adds an electric filament lamp (60W) in the central authorities that are positioned at the cultivation pond apart from water surface 1m place, be connected on the variable resistance of cultivating outside the pond and intervalometer with other control light modulation, utilize variable resistance and intervalometer regulation and control intensity of illumination to weaken gradually, reduced to behind the 50Lux prolonged exposure gradually 15 minutes by 280Lux.Along with the evening lamp lighting time of putting off of normal illumination time is postponed half an hour every day.The effect of evening lamp is simulate natural ecological environment, and the natural environment that the Cynoglossus semilaevis parent fish is experienced under the simulated conditions gradually changes, and impels male and female parent fish gonad to grow synchronously and the synchronous spawning fertilization, and the regulation and control parent fish laid eggs in regular time every day.
3). experimental result:
Under temperature, light regulation and control, the ratio of Cynoglossus semilaevis parent fish gonad development and total length such as following table.When parent fish gonad length and total length ratio reach 0.51 gonadal maturation of parent fish when above, but natural spawning.
The cultivation time (d) 20 30 40 50 60 70 80
Gonad length and total length ratio 0.25 9 0.32 9 0.39 6 0.45 9 0.50 9 0.52 9 0.543
In the time of 2 months, the Cynoglossus semilaevis parent fish begins to lay eggs at control light, temperature control in this experiment, and the whole egg-laying season continues 42 days altogether, 30 batches on common property ovum, and wherein the good ovum amount of every day all reached more than the 300ml in order to concentrate spawning period in 22 days.Obtain high quality fertilized egg of scophthatmus 7390ml (see figure 1) altogether, fertilization rate reached to 90%, incubation rate reaches 85%, obtains ten thousand tails surplus high-quality, the healthy newly hatched larvae 600 altogether.The egg-laying time of parent fish every day was all closed back about 2 hours at evening lamp, and the advantage place that evening lamp is set has been described.
Embodiment two: loyal sea water produces company limited and carries out illumination, the temperature adjusting Cynoglossus semilaevis parent fish technology large-scale production test of laying eggs in Qingdao.
1). the selection of parent fish and throwing something and feeding:
Select Cynoglossus semilaevis parent fish 65 tails for use, raun: milter=1: 1.5, raun average weight 2315 grams, milter average weight 278 grams.The parent fish bodily form, body colour are normal, healthy not damaged.The parent fish age: raun and milter were more than 3 ages.Parent fish is put into the circular cement cultivation pond cultivation of smearing the angle, and (area is 25m 2, depth of water 1m).Cultivating water is the sand filtration nature seawater, cultivates the adjusting of water temperature with boiler and refrigeration machine.Condition of water quality is: DO>6.0mg/L, pH=8.0-8.2, salinity 30-33.
The feedstuff of parent fish: bait is based on the clam worm that lives, shellfish meat.Day throw something and feed 2 times, a day feeding volume is the 2%-3% of fish body body weight, and the reinforcement that began to carry out living bait preceding 3 months of mating period is thrown something and fed, and promotes the growth of parent fish gonad, keeps the high rate of throwing something and feeding whole mating period.When parent fish begins to lay eggs, change the clam worm alive of throwing something and feeding fully into.When throwing something and feeding, note avoiding noise, and in time remove residual bait, blowdown.
2). the water temperature regulate and control of parent fish:
The artificial regulatory water temperature slowly is elevated to 25 ℃ by 18 ℃ gradually.Rise 1 ℃ until rising to 25 ℃ and keep a period of time every 7 days water temperatures.When finding that parent fish lays eggs on a small quantity, every day, water temperature descended 0.5 ℃, to 24 ℃ and remain unchanged.The cultivation pond water temperature amplitude of variation of water temperature control period every day is no more than ± and 0.2 ℃.
3). the illumination regulation and control of parent fish:
The parent fish rearing pond is hidden fully with the light tight tarpaulin of black, highly locate for 1 meter to hang electric filament lamp at the cultivation pond water surface, the adjusting intensity of illumination is 280Lux.The control light application time is 8 hours when water temperature is 19 ℃, increases light application time 30 minutes in later per 5 days, reaches 13 hours until light application time and remains unchanged, and accurately manages the light application time of every day with intervalometer.
4). evening lamp is set: (with embodiment one).
5). experimental result:
Through the regulation and control of 2 first quarter moons, Cynoglossus semilaevis parent fish gonad development in cultivating the pond is ripe synchronously, and nature, lays eggs in batches.Continue 46 days whole idiophase, wherein spawning period continues 26 days, more than the good ovum amount 600ml of every day, obtains high quality fertilized egg of scophthatmus 13610ml (see figure 2) altogether, fertilization rate reached 92%, and incubation rate is 86.6%, ten thousand tails surplus the newly hatched larvae 1000 that secures good health altogether.The egg-laying time of parent fish every day is all closed the back about 2-3 hour at evening lamp, and egg-laying time concentrates, regularly, and the effect that evening lamp has been described is tangible.
